Carbonation Resistance Classes of Concretes [PDF]
Concrete carbonation is a phenomenon that occurs by the penetration into the cement stone of CO2 present in the atmosphere. The phenomenon occurs in the presence of water in which CO2 dissolves, forming carbonate ions, which in turn react with calcium ...

Influence of alkali content and silica modulus on the carbonation kinetics of alkali-activated slag concrete [PDF]
Carbonation is inevitable process during the service life of concrete structures, where CO2 causes decalcification of the calcium-bearing phases. These changes affect the durability of concrete and accelerate the corrosion of reinforcement.
